Syllabus
- Module 1: History and Overview of Artificial Intelligence
- This module offers a comprehensive introduction to AI, encompassing its historical development, fundamental mechanisms, ethical considerations, and regulatory landscapes.
- Module 2: Machine Learning Basics
- This module introduces learners to the foundational techniques of machine learning, focusing on how data-driven models classify, predict, and group information to generate actionable insights. This module provides a comprehensive understanding of three key machine learning approaches—Classification, Regression, and Clustering—and their applications in solving real-world problems.
- Module 3: Deep Learning and Generative AI
- This module delves into advanced concepts of artificial intelligence, emphasizing how machines can process, interpret, and create complex data. This module introduces learners to the cutting-edge techniques that power today’s AI systems, such as neural networks, deep learning architectures, and generative models.
- Module 4: The Future of AI and Artificial General Intelligence (AGI)
- This module explores the transformative potential and challenges associated with AGI and its evolution toward superintelligence. The module provides learners with insights into the technological, societal, and ethical implications of AI advancements, focusing on preparing for a future shaped by these powerful technologies.
